The leading and lagging
Which measures move before the outcome and which after.
The part
What it is
A leading measure permits a response; a lagging one permits an explanation. Both are needed and only one is usually present.
Leading measures are harder to choose because the relationship to the outcome is a hypothesis rather than a fact.
